== Polish ==
=== Etymology ===
Borrowed from French cothurne, from Latin cothurnus, from Ancient Greek κόθορνος (kóthornos).
=== Pronunciation ===
IPA(key): /ˈkɔ.turn/
Rhymes: -ɔturn
Syllabification: ko‧turn
=== Noun ===
koturn m inan
(historical, Ancient greek, theater) buskin, cothurnus
(by extension) buskin (over-acting)
